About Robert L. Bertini
Robert L. Bertini is a scholar working on Transportation, Building and Construction, Control and Systems Engineering, Safety, Risk, Reliability and Quality and Automotive Engineering, having authored 174 papers that have together received 2.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Traffic Prediction and Management Techniques (123 papers), Transportation Planning and Optimization (121 papers), Traffic control and management (83 papers), Traffic and Road Safety (25 papers), Urban Transport and Accessibility (14 papers), Data Management and Algorithms (13 papers), Vehicle emissions and performance (9 papers) and Transportation and Mobility Innovations (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Transportation (2.1k citations), Building and Construction (1.7k citations), Control and Systems Engineering (1.7k citations), Safety, Risk, Reliability and Quality (449 citations) and Automotive Engineering (494 citations). Robert L. Bertini has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Germany and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Michael J. Cassidy, Ahmed El-Geneidy, Mark Cassidy, Klaus Bogenberger, Carlos F. Daganzo, Christopher Monsere, Thomas J. Kimpel, James G. Strathman, Martin Treiber and Meead Saberi. Their work appears in journals such as Transportation Research Record Journal of the Transportation Research Board, Journal of Intelligent Transportation Systems, Transportation Research Part C Emerging Technologies, Journal of Transportation Engineering and IEEE Transactions on Intelligent Transportation Systems.
